HTML content can be minified and compressed by a website’s server. The most efficient way is to compress content using GZIP which reduces data amount travelling through the network between server and browser. This page needs HTML code to be minified as it can gain 2.6 kB, which is 16% of the original size. It is highly recommended that content of this web page should be compressed using GZIP, as it can save up to 12.7 kB or 75% of the original size.

It’s better to minify JavaScript in order to improve website performance. The diagram shows the current total size of all JavaScript files against the prospective JavaScript size after its minification and compression. It is highly recommended that all JavaScript files should be compressed and minified as it can save up to 88.0 kB or 70% of the original size.
Potential reduce by 35.1 kB
CSS files minification is very important to reduce a web page rendering time. The faster CSS files can load, the earlier a page can be rendered. Fadeweb.uncoma.edu.ar needs all CSS files to be minified and compressed as it can save up to 35.1 kB or 82% of the original size.

Language claimed in HTML meta tag should match the language actually used on the web page. Otherwise Fadeweb.uncoma.edu.ar can be misinterpreted by Google and other search engines. Our service has detected that Spanish is used on the page, and neither this language nor any other was claimed in <html> or <meta> tags. Our system also found out that Fadeweb.uncoma.edu.ar main page’s claimed encoding is iso-8859-1. Changing it to UTF-8 can be a good choice, as this format is commonly used for encoding all over the web and thus their visitors won’t have any troubles with symbol transcription or reading.

Open Graph description is not detected on the main page of Fa De Web Uncoma. Lack of Open Graph description can be counter-productive for their social media presence, as such a description allows converting a website homepage (or other pages) into good-looking, rich and well-structured posts, when it is being shared on Facebook and other social media.
